- Rusty, By a letter dated August 27, 2010 (Agencywide Documents Access and Management System (ADAMS) Accession No.ML102510161), Arizona Public Service Company (APS) requested a license amendment to Operating Licenses NPF-41, NPF-51, and NPF-74, for Palo Verde Nuclear Generating Station (PVNGS) Units 1, 2, and 3 respectively, to allow credit for reducing the available time for an existing manual operator action to initiate pressurizer level control. The revised analysis would assume that the action is initiated at twenty minutes into the scenario as opposed to the current assumption of thirty minutes. The staff requested additional information in its letter dated December 21, 2010 (ADAMS Accession No.ML103500510). The licensee responded with supplementary information in its submittal dated February 11, 2011 (ADAMS Accession No. ML110550323).
The NRC staff has reviewed the information provided by APS and determined that the additional information requested in the attachment to this e-mail message is needed to complete its review of the LAR. In order to complete our review of the LAR in a timely manner, please submit your response to the attached RAI by May 2, 2011.
